Mobile Scheduling Software – The Key to Faster Turnaround Periods
In today's competitive landscape, streamlined service operations demand more than just skilled technicians; they require a robust system for managing and deploying them. Mobile dispatch solutions provides that crucial advantage, acting as the linchpin for significantly reducing response times. Using relying on phone calls or spreadsheets is simply not scalable nor does it permit real-time visibility into technician availability and location, leading to delays and frustrated customers. Modern dispatch platforms offer features such as automated assignment based on skill set with proximity, dynamic routing adjustments, and instant communication capabilities – all contributing to a markedly quicker arrival time for service professionals. This heightened agility translates directly into increased customer satisfaction, improved first-time fix rates, and ultimately, greater profitability for your organization.

Contractor CRM vs. Service Dispatch: What's the Difference?
Many organizations in the service sector find themselves unsure about the distinction between a Contractor CRM system and a Service Scheduling platform. A CRM primarily focuses on tracking client relationships, sales, and marketing efforts. It helps you build rapport with prospects and nurture them through the buying journey. Conversely, Service Dispatch software is centered around the operational aspects of your team; it excels at improving job assignment, technician routing, invoicing, and overall field service execution. Essentially, a CRM helps you *get* clients, while dispatch helps you *serve* them efficiently – although increasingly, these solutions are beginning to overlap, offering all-in-one functionality.
